RSS-3.315/H DC DC Converter 15V 1W Equivalent & Substitute Parts

Part Overview

The RSS-3.315/H is an isolated module DC DC converter manufactured by Recom Power, designed to convert 3V to 3.6V input to a regulated 15V output at 66mA maximum current with 1W power rating. This component is classified as obsolete, necessitating identification of active equivalent parts for new designs and ongoing production requirements. The part features 3 kV isolation, short circuit protection (SCP), and compliance with ROHS3 and REACH standards, making it suitable for ITE (Commercial) and Medical applications.

Key Parameters

Parameter Value
Voltage - Input Range 3V to 3.6V
Voltage - Output 15V
Current - Output (Max) 66mA
Power Rating 1W
Voltage - Isolation 3 kV
Number of Outputs 1
Mounting Type Surface Mount
Package / Case 8-SMD Module, 5 Leads
Operating Temperature Range -40°C to 85°C
Efficiency 82%
Features SCP (Short Circuit Protection)
RoHS Status ROHS3 Compliant
Moisture Sensitivity Level 1 (Unlimited)

Engineering Selection Recommendations

The R1S-3.315/H is the direct substitute for the obsolete RSS-3.315/H based on complete electrical and mechanical parameter equivalence. Selection of the R1S-3.315/H is supported by the following factors:

Product Status: The R1S-3.315/H maintains active product status with Recom Power, ensuring ongoing availability and supply chain continuity compared to the obsolete RSS-3.315/H.

Compliance Certifications: Both parts maintain identical ROHS3 compliance and REACH unaffected status, satisfying regulatory requirements for ITE (Commercial) and Medical applications without additional qualification.

Thermal Performance: The R1S-3.315/H extends the maximum operating temperature from 85°C to 100°C, providing enhanced thermal margin for applications operating at elevated ambient conditions while maintaining all other electrical specifications.

Packaging & Footprint: Identical 8-SMD Module, 5 Leads package configuration and surface mount designation enable direct PCB layout compatibility without redesign.

Electrical Equivalence: All critical electrical parameters including input voltage range (3V to 3.6V), output voltage (15V), maximum output current (66mA), power rating (1W), isolation voltage (3 kV), and efficiency (82%) are identical, ensuring functional interchangeability.

Frequently Asked Questions (FAQ)

Q: Can the R1S-3.315/H be used as a direct replacement for the RSS-3.315/H in existing designs?

A: Yes. The R1S-3.315/H provides complete electrical and mechanical equivalence to the RSS-3.315/H. All critical parameters including input/output voltage specifications, current ratings, isolation voltage, package type, and compliance certifications are identical. The component can be substituted without circuit modification or PCB redesign.

Q: What is the primary difference between the RSS-3.315/H and R1S-3.315/H?

A: The primary differences are product status and operating temperature range. The RSS-3.315/H is obsolete with a maximum operating temperature of 85°C, while the R1S-3.315/H is an active product with an extended maximum operating temperature of 100°C. All electrical specifications and package configurations remain identical.

Q: Are there any package or footprint differences between these parts?

A: No. Both the RSS-3.315/H and R1S-3.315/H use identical 8-SMD Module, 5 Leads packaging with the same surface mount configuration. PCB layouts and assembly processes require no modification.

Q: Do both parts meet the same compliance standards?

A: Yes. Both the RSS-3.315/H and R1S-3.315/H are ROHS3 compliant and REACH unaffected. They are suitable for identical applications in ITE (Commercial) and Medical environments without additional compliance qualification.

Q: What is the significance of the extended operating temperature range in the R1S-3.315/H?

A: The R1S-3.315/H extends the maximum operating temperature from 85°C to 100°C. This provides additional thermal margin for applications exposed to elevated ambient conditions or high-density thermal environments, while maintaining all other electrical performance characteristics.

Q: Is the R1S-3.315/H available in the same packaging options as the RSS-3.315/H?

A: The R1S-3.315/H is supplied in Tube packaging, while the RSS-3.315/H was supplied in standard packaging. Both use identical component-level package types (8-SMD Module, 5 Leads). Packaging format does not affect electrical performance or PCB compatibility.

Q: Can the R1S-3.315/H handle the same input voltage range as the RSS-3.315/H?

A: Yes. Both parts accept identical input voltage specifications of 3V to 3.6V and deliver identical 15V output at 66mA maximum current. Input voltage tolerance and regulation characteristics are equivalent.

Q: Are there any thermal or efficiency differences between these parts?

A: No. Both parts maintain 82% efficiency and identical thermal characteristics under rated load conditions. The extended operating temperature range of the R1S-3.315/H refers to the maximum ambient temperature the component can withstand, not a change in thermal performance.
